Job ID: 249378 – Ministry of Education, Provincial and Demonstration Schools Branch, W. Ross Macdonald School for the Blind, Brantford. Job term: 1 Temporary, Fixed-Term position (available September 2026 until June 2027, duration up to 10 months). Job code: U0114 – Classroom Assistant. Salary: $24.61 – $27.14 per hour (as per the OPSEU Collective Agreement).

Competition #: PDSB26-146. Posting status: Open.

The Ministry of Education, W. Ross Macdonald School for the Blind is a community-based School for the Blind, under the Ministry of Education, Provincial and Demonstration Schools Branch, with the tradition and reputation for meeting the academic, personal, social, emotional, and developmental needs of the individual children.

If you are looking for a rewarding and meaningful career and would like to be part of a specialized team, then consider this exciting employment opportunity as a Classroom Assistant.

About the job

  • Work with children who are visually impaired with multiple exceptionalities.
  • Work in a multi-disciplinary setting.
  • Assist in providing individual and group programs to children who are visually impaired with multiple exceptionalities.
  • Assist with physical needs of children.
  • Follow up on specialized programs set up by other agencies and professionals.
  • Assist in program preparation and materials.

What you bring to the team

Mandatory requirements

  • Community College certificate and/or equivalent training, education and working experience in a child-related field.
  • Current certification in Standard First Aid and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) with AED.

Skills and qualifications

  • Demonstrated experience working with children who are visually impaired and may have other emotional and behavioural disorders.
  • Knowledge of child development and an understanding of caring for children with special needs.
  • Knowledge of relevant legislation, policies, procedures, guidelines and practices that address student care and safety.
  • Excellent analytical, problem solving and observation skills to identify students’ needs and difficulties.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with students who may have a variety of multiple exceptionalities in an educational setting.
  • Ability to work effectively as a member of a multi-disciplinary team.
  • Behaviour Management Systems (BMS) certification is an asset.
  • Ability and willingness to assist special needs students as required.
